Vitamin C and the Common Cold, by Linus Pauling

By following the simple, inexpensive and safe regimen described in this book, you can greatly reduce your chances of catching cold and, at the same time, improve your general health. So contends its Nobel Prize-winning author Linus Pouling. Despite widespread popular belief in its effectiveness in preventing and combatting the common cold, vitamin C (ascorbic acid) is still discounted by many medical and nutritional authorities s a useful preventative treatment. Now Professor Pauling, after carefully reexamining the evidence and conducting his own tests, concludes that when properly used this naturally occurring food substance - far safer than the drugs usually prescribed or recommended for colds - is thoroughly effective in both the prevention and the alleviation of the common cold and related diseases.

Linus Pauling is a real hero
By Jodi-Hummingbird
Linus Pauling is a real hero to me and his intelligence, logic and compassion for people come through on every page of this book. The world would be a far better place with more people like him in it.

Having said that, after reading this book I do think it is clear he continually honed his message and the basic points he wanted to make about nutrition and orthomolecular medicine as time went on. For that reason I would recommend reading Pauling's book 'How to Live Longer and Feel Better' above this earlier (though still excellent and historially very important) book.

'How to Live Longer and Feel Better' includes a lot of the excellent vitamin C infomation contained in this book but also so much more. The discussion has a lot more depth, more research is quoted and practical advice is given about a basic but fairly complete orthomolecular program and not just how much vitamin C to take. It is pretty wonderful.

This is a slightly paraphrased version of Pauling's basic regimen for a healthy life:
* Take 6 - 18 g of vitamin C daily
* Take 400 IU, 800 IU or 1600 IU of natural vitamin E daily
* Take 1 - 2 B vitamin supplements daily
* Take 25 000 IU of vitamin A daily
* Take a multimineral tablet daily
* Keep your intake of sugar low
* Eat what you like in moderation, but avoid sugar. Meat and eggs are good, and fruit and vegetables are good. Don't eat too much of any one food and don't eat so much that you become overweight.
* Drink plenty of water
* Keep active, but do not severely overexert yourself physically.
* Drink alcohol in moderation only
* DO NOT SMOKE CIGARETTES
* Avoid stress, work at a job you like, be happy with your family.

This is just such a great and simple list, I had to type it out for those who can't read/afford the book. (Note that Pauling comments that the amounts given for supplements are for healthy people, and that those suffering serious illness may need higher doses of some of these, including vitamin C to bowel tolerance.)

Best-Loved Folktales of the World (The Anchor folktale library), by Joanna Cole

This collection of over two hundred folk and fairy tales from all over the world is the only edition that encompasses all cultures. Arranged geographically by region—West and East Europe, British Isles, Scandinavia, and Northern Europe, Middle East, Asia, the Pacific, Africa, North America, the Carribean and West Indies, and Central and South America—and lovingly selected from the personal favorites of folklorists and writers, this book is a major anthology in its field.
Gathered together in this wide-ranging collection are familiar classics like "Snow-White" and "Sleeping Beauty," and stories that equal them from all major cultures. Together they offer magic, adventure, laughter, reflection, vivid images, and a throng of colorful characters. More important, they offer insight into the oral traditions of different cultures and deal with universal human dilemmas that span differences of age, culture, and geography. Animal fables, proverbs, ghost  stories, funny tales, and tales of enchantment provide a unique reading experience for all ages.
A category index groups the tales by plot and character, e.g., humorous, supernatural, and "pourquoi" tales, married couples, enchanted sweethearts, etc. Like all great literature, these tales can be read with fascination on many levels, making Best-Loved Folktales of the World a classic and enduring collection.

About the Author
Joanna Cole has taught elementary school, worked with a news magazine, and was for several years a senior editor of children’s books. Today she is a full-time author writing for children. She is best known as the author of the Magic School Bus series. She has written more than 90 nonfiction and fiction books for children, and she is the winner of the 1991 Washington Post /Children's Book Guild Nonfiction award for the body of her work. She lives in Connecticut with her husband and daughter.

Modelling Panzer Crewmen of the Heer (Osprey Modelling), by Mark Bannerman

Adding a figure to a kit or display can increase both depth and interest, yet building and painting figures continues to be a source of frustration to many armour modelers. This book provides full details on how to build and integrate realistic Heer Panzer crew figures with their vehicles, and on how to paint the key uniform variants and patterns worn by these distinctive troops.

It begins with a brief discussion of the various mediums (plastic, resin and white metal), and a round up of the tools, materials and aftermarket items suitable for building and super-detailing figures. Using differing theatres and periods of the war, it shows how to paint common clothing types and patterns, such as the black panzer uniform, Splittermuster, feldgrau, and fatigues, as well as unique and fascinating variants such as Russian camouflage fabric and the motorcycle rubber coat.

Special effects, such as dust-covering, and the addition of equipment and and other details are also covered in clear, step-by-step tutorials. The book will also challenge and inspire the more experienced crew figure modeler, with clearly explained 'kit-bashing' and scratch-building demonstrations, making this a treatment of the subject with wide appeal.

Good beginner figure painting book
By Thomas Paine
If you like modeling 1/35th or 1/48th scale German armor and have wanted to add figures, this book is for you. The core of the text covers painting WWII panzer crewmen in miniature using enamels and oils and only lightly touches on conversions and scupting.

The basic uniforms covered include:
Panzer Black (The most common uniform worn)
Afrika Korp (also known as Tropical uniform)
Reed Green Denim (introduced in 1942)

The focus of the work is the use of shading and hilighting techniques with enamel paints to create a realistic looking uniform in miniature. The author begins with the Panzer Black uniform which is very easy and a great place to start for a beginner. The author then moves on to Afrika Korp and Reed Green Denim uniforms which are not really much harder.

The book has further sections on painting faces, sculpting figures and weathering uniforms. The face painting section is very good but requires a commitment to the use of artists oils. Using artist oils is a little tricky and more advice there would have been nice. However, face painting with oils, once mastered, will deliver a great result. The section on sculpting is really too brief and was the least useful to me.

Overall this is a grood book for anyone struggling to start adding figures to their German armor models.

Modelling Panzer Crewmen of the Heer
By Walter A. Jacque
In modeling and painting military miniatures, there have been very few that were decent enough to be a constant reference. First was Peter Blum's "Model Soldiers" (published, by the way, by Imrie/Risley). Then we had Almark's work by Roy Dilley and D.S.V. Fosten. Unfortunately in both works, we had drawings, but no photos of actual work.

Now we have "Modelling Panzer Crewmen of the Heer," and what a nice work it is! Bannerman's photos and descriptions of how he painted the cover figure are well worth the price of the book. The book also has articles on converting and painting an early war panzer officer as well as an article on how to do 1/48 figures (good also for aircraft figures). In fact, this is one of those books that transcends the subject matter, as anyone can use Bannerman's painting tips on other figures from other nations, as well as time periods.

Perhaps surpassing this book is the bonus DVD put out by "Armor Models" magazine (out of print, pity), but this is mostly in Japanese (no subtitles), with one part in English featuring MMiR's Pat Stancil. Still, "Modelling Panzer Crewmen of the Heer" is well-worth the price, and is an excellent reference work on light conversions and painting figures.
